All-Met lineman chooses national champs
DeMatha All-Met offensive lineman Arie Kouandjio, the top remaining uncommitted player locally, on Tuesday afternoon committed to play for Alabama....

Another DeMatha lineman named all-American
DeMatha junior offensive lineman Cyrus Kouandjio, who is 6 feet 7 and 295 pounds and already holds more than a dozen scholarship offers, has been selected to play in next year's U.S. Army All-American Bowl. Game organizers announced the first 19 players for the game, including linebacker Curtis Grant from...
